Shams reported that Alexander and the Thunder reached an early contract renewal of a super maximum salary, with a contract of $285 million for 4 years, which will make him the highest annual salary in NBA history! This past season has been a season that Alexander personally and the Thunder team gained. Alexander performed well in both the regular season and the playoffs, winning the regular season MVP scoring champion and the finals MVP. Help the Thunder win the championship. In the past season, Alexander averaged 32.7 points, 5 rebounds, 6.4 assists, 1.7 steals and 1 block per game; he averaged 29.9 points, 5.3 rebounds, 6.5 assists, 1.7 steals and 0.9 blocks per game in the playoffs. His performance was also recognized by the management, and he reached an early contract renewal with the team.
This contract allowed Alexander and the Thunder to cooperate until the 30-31 season, while Alexander's salary for the 30-31 season was $78.77 million because the rules failed to break through to an annual salary of 80 million. According to statistics, Alexander's contract is the second largest contract in the history of the NBA, second only to Tatum's five-year 314 million signed in 2024. Bucks were completely unexpected and they cut Lillard. Lillard returned after suffering from injury last season, and tore off the season in the playoffs against the Pacers, and then the team was eliminated. Antetokounmpo was also revealed that it may leave the Bucks, which also made the Bucks management want to strengthen the lineup in the offseason so that Antetokounmpo's chances of maintaining the championship.
They grabbed Turner from the Pacers with a four-year contract of 107 million, which not only made up for the inside problems caused by Daluo's departure but also further improved. At the same time, they used the extension clause to sack Lillard and extended his remaining $113 million contract to distribute it to the next five seasons. Many teams are strengthening the Nuggets and are not idle. The Nuggets' operations have been excellent since the offseason. They completed 2 for 1 and sent away the only active first-round pick in 32 years and Porter Jr. for Cameron Johnson, which was a good addition to the team's problem points. At the same time, they signed Bruce Brown, and then completed a batch of 1 for 1, finding a substitute for Jokic.
Trade sent Saric away and got Valan. Last season, Valan was sent to the Kings by the Wizards, and he also got a certain chance in the Kings. Salic doesn't have many opportunities in the Nuggets. This operation allowed the Nuggets to get rid of Salic's contract and was well supplemented by the inside. It can be said that it was another perfect operation.
